Virginia, Illinois and Texas A&M jump out to early leads
The race is on and the Virginia and Illinois men and Texas A&M women are the early leaders in the inaugural ITA Attendance Race. The Virginia men are tops in the total attendance with 4,208 fans through their first eight matches this season, all played indoors at the Boyd Tinsley Tennis Courts at Boars Head Tennis Center. Illinois leads the nation in average attendance with 635 fans per match at the Atkins Tennis Center. Fittingly, the Illinois-Virginia match at Atkins drew a season-high 1,231 spectators (pictured, above). Texas A&M leads the way in all the women's categories with 1,777 total fans through three home matches this season, good for a 592 per match average, both lead the nation. The first standings reflect matches through January and February.

Highlighting the ITA Attendance Race thus far are the nearly 25,000 fans taking in the first stretch of home matches for the  top 14 men's race leaders (mainly at indoor facilities with limited capacity).
